A reputable sash window company can repair and draught proof your original windows, and install new double-glazed ones. They can also add a removable pane to the inside of your windows, which is acceptable to planning departments. This will not harm your historic fabric. In addition to draughtproofing and double-glazing, they could also repair or replace damaged wood, replace perished putty, and offer various other services. They can offer low-e double glazing that is eight times more efficient than single-glazing and has a lower U-value. This type of glass is more durable, reduces condensation and improves thermal insulation. They can also install the vacuum double glazing system that is more effective than the conventional glass filled with argon. They can also replace rotten sections timber, re-hang and fit new sash pulleys as well as repair or replace draught boxes, casement locks and hinges. Double glazing installers With rising energy costs and rising, it's more crucial than ever to get your home to be as efficient as is possible. Double glazing can help reduce the cost of heating by preventing heat from passing through your windows and doors. It also makes your house more comfortable since it helps keep warm air in. Additionally, it can boost the value of your property and improve its safety. When choosing a double-glazing company it is crucial to look at the quality of customer service. Find companies with excellent scores on review websites, such as Trustpilot. Find accreditations, such as FENSA which oversees the compliance of building regulations. In addition, verify if the company is a member of the Glass and Glazing Federation or a TrustMark registered business.
